WebApr 22, 1988 · Reflex neurovascular dystrophy (RND) presents as pain in an extremity with associated autonomic dysfunction (cool and/or cyanotic skin, swelling, and marked limitation of function). In adults with RND there is almost always a precipitating event, whereas in children a precipitating factor has been identified in only half the cases.
